/* * Hibernate, Relational Persistence for Idiomatic Java * * License: GNU Lesser General Public License (LGPL), version 2.1 or later. * See the lgpl.txt file in the root directory or <http://www.gnu.org/licenses/lgpl-2.1.html>. */ package org.hibernate.event.internal; import org.hibernate.HibernateException; import org.hibernate.engine.spi.PersistenceContext; import org.hibernate.event.spi.EventSource; import org.hibernate.event.spi.FlushEvent; import org.hibernate.event.spi.FlushEventListener; /** * Defines the default flush event listeners used by hibernate for * flushing session state in response to generated flush events. * * @author Steve Ebersole */ public class DefaultFlushEventListener extends AbstractFlushingEventListener implements FlushEventListener { /** Handle the given flush event. * * @param event The flush event to be handled. * @throws HibernateException */ public void onFlush(FlushEvent event) throws HibernateException { final EventSource source = event.getSession(); final PersistenceContext persistenceContext = source.getPersistenceContext(); if ( persistenceContext.getNumberOfManagedEntities() > 0 || persistenceContext.getCollectionEntries().size() > 0 ) { try { source.getEventListenerManager().flushStart(); flushEverythingToExecutions( event ); performExecutions( source ); postFlush( source ); } finally { source.getEventListenerManager().flushEnd( event.getNumberOfEntitiesProcessed(), event.getNumberOfCollectionsProcessed() ); } postPostFlush( source ); if ( source.getFactory().getStatistics().isStatisticsEnabled() ) { source.getFactory().getStatistics().flush(); } } } }
